Transaction 63f0fd4fb25703887391a51a97c189e6797c167ffbdb2d206271dcf9898a4eb7
1 Input
1 Output
-
63f0fd4fb25703887391a51a97c189e6797c167ffbdb2d206271dcf9898a4eb7:0
- value
- 49135563
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d56cee36e1ecc2a004201058b51946818619d1188f0361e7528b7e31e06f8be1
- address
- bc1p64kwudhpanp2qppqzpvt2x2xsxrpn5gc3upkre6j3dlrrcr030ss9cf8dn